Understanding Credit Card Protections

Credit card protections are safeguards put in place by credit card issuers to protect cardholders from various risks and liabilities. These protections can include fraud protection, dispute resolution services, and insurance coverage. By understanding these protections, cardholders can better navigate the world of credit cards and make informed decisions about their financial well-being.

One of the most important credit card protections is fraud protection. This protection helps cardholders in case their card is lost or stolen, or if unauthorized transactions occur. Many credit card issuers have zero liability policies that protect cardholders from having to pay for fraudulent charges. Additionally, some credit cards offer purchase protection, which covers certain purchases in case they are damaged or stolen within a certain time frame.

Another key credit card protection is dispute resolution services. If a cardholder has a dispute with a merchant over a purchase, they can contact their credit card issuer to help resolve the issue. The issuer will investigate the dispute and may issue a chargeback if the cardholder is found to be in the right. This protection can help cardholders avoid financial losses due to faulty products or services.

Key Protections Every Cardholder Should Know

In addition to fraud protection and dispute resolution services, there are several other key protections that every cardholder should be aware of. One of these protections is travel insurance, which some credit cards offer as a benefit. This insurance can cover things like trip cancellations, lost luggage, and medical emergencies while traveling.

Another important protection is extended warranty coverage. Some credit cards automatically extend the manufacturer’s warranty on certain purchases, giving cardholders extra peace of mind when making big-ticket purchases. Price protection is another valuable protection that some credit cards offer, refunding the price difference if a purchased item goes on sale shortly after the purchase.
